How can I locate my Microsoft Outlook OAuth credentials in n8n?

The post content has been automatically edited by the Moderator Agent for consistency and clarity.

I'm trying to establish a connection with Microsoft Outlook using n8n. The instructions mention that I need to paste my n8n OAuth Callback URL, but I can't see the screen as shown in the tutorial video.

In the MS Outlook node, there is only a “connect my account” button instead of the expected input fields (e.g., MS ID, secret, OAuth Callback URL). It immediately redirects to the Microsoft login page.

I'm currently using a trial account. Is this functionality exclusive to higher plans, or have I missed a configuration step?
